When I click on the drop-down list for recently visited sites the drop-down
window is always about 10 or so pixels from the left edge of the screen. It is
lined up correctly in the "y" coordinate, but the "x" coordinate always seems to
be about 10 or so. In addition, since this problem has persisted that some web
sites do not display correctly any more ( e.g. www.warp2search.com ), but I
don't know if there is any correlation or not. I can send a screen shot of the
feature if so desired.
